What is Continuous Glucose Monitoring (CGM)?
A Continuous Glucose Monitor (CGM) is a medical device that tracks glucose levels continuously throughout the day and night, providing a dynamic and real-time picture of glucose trends. Unlike traditional blood glucose meters, which require fingerstick tests, CGMs offer a more convenient and non-invasive approach to monitor blood sugar.
A typical CGM system consists of three main components:
- Sensor: A small sensor that is inserted under the skin (usually on the abdomen or arm). The sensor measures glucose levels in the interstitial fluid (the fluid between cells) and sends the data to a transmitter.
- Transmitter: A device that attaches to the sensor and wirelessly sends glucose data to a receiver or smartphone.
- Receiver/Smartphone App: The device or app that displays real-time glucose readings and trends, allowing users to track fluctuations in glucose levels.
Some systems offer the added benefit of alarms or notifications, alerting the user when their glucose levels are too high or too low. This can help individuals make timely adjustments to their diet, physical activity, or medication.
How Does CGM Work?
The process behind CGM technology is both simple and sophisticated. The sensor continuously measures glucose levels in the interstitial fluid, which reflects the glucose concentration in the bloodstream. These readings are sent to the transmitter, which communicates with a receiver or smartphone app. The system updates glucose data every few minutes, offering near real-time monitoring.
Unlike fingerstick tests that provide a snapshot of glucose at a specific moment, CGMs provide a continuous flow of information, allowing individuals to observe glucose trends over hours and even days. This provides a much more comprehensive picture of blood sugar control, especially when it comes to identifying patterns like post-meal spikes or overnight lows that can be difficult to detect with traditional methods.
Benefits of Continuous Glucose Monitoring
The advantages of CGM extend beyond just convenience. Here are some of the key benefits:
1. Real-Time Glucose Data
One of the primary benefits of CGM is the ability to view real-time glucose readings. This helps individuals make immediate adjustments to their diet, exercise, or insulin therapy. For instance, if a user notices a rise in blood sugar after eating a specific meal, they can adjust their insulin dose or make dietary modifications accordingly.
2. Increased Accuracy in Managing Diabetes
Traditional blood glucose testing provides only a single reading at a time, whereas CGM allows users to track fluctuations throughout the day. This continuous data enables more precise adjustments to insulin dosage or lifestyle choices, making it easier to maintain target blood glucose levels.
3. Alerts and Alarms
CGMs often come with customizable alerts, which can notify users if their glucose levels are too high or too low. This proactive feature helps prevent hypoglycemia (dangerously low blood sugar) or hyperglycemia (high blood sugar), both of which can have serious consequences if left unaddressed. These alerts can be particularly helpful at night when symptoms may not be felt until the blood sugar level is significantly outside the target range.
4. Better A1C Control
Studies have shown that people who use CGM devices regularly tend to have better control over their A1C levels, which is a measure of average blood glucose over 2-3 months. With continuous feedback, individuals can make timely decisions to adjust their therapy, reducing the frequency of extreme highs and lows that can impact A1C levels.
5. Reduced Fingersticks
One of the most convenient aspects of CGM is that it significantly reduces the need for painful fingerstick tests. While it’s still important to perform occasional blood glucose checks for calibration and to ensure accuracy, CGM minimizes the number of times you need to test manually.
6. Increased Empowerment and Peace of Mind
CGM gives individuals with diabetes more control over their condition. The ability to view glucose levels on a smartphone app or receiver in real-time provides a sense of empowerment and reassurance. It’s particularly beneficial for parents of children with diabetes or caregivers who want to monitor their loved ones without intrusive testing.
Who Can Benefit from CGM?
CGM can be beneficial for a wide range of individuals with diabetes, from those who require intensive insulin therapy to people who struggle to maintain stable blood glucose levels. Here are a few groups who may benefit from CGM technology:
- People with Type 1 Diabetes: For individuals who take multiple daily insulin injections or use an insulin pump, CGM can provide critical insights into how their insulin regimen is working and how their glucose levels fluctuate throughout the day.
- People with Type 2 Diabetes: Those who have difficulty managing their glucose levels through diet, exercise, and oral medication may benefit from CGM as a tool for making more informed decisions about their treatment.
- Pregnant Women with Gestational Diabetes: CGM can help pregnant women with gestational diabetes better manage their blood sugar and prevent complications for both mother and baby.
- Athletes and Active Individuals: CGM can help people who exercise regularly track how physical activity affects their glucose levels, helping them optimize their workouts and prevent hypoglycemia during or after exercise.
